Question:
We are wondering if we can open our slides with this at our house?
asked by: Suzanne M
0
Expert Reply:
Yes, you will be able to open your rv slides with the Mighty Cord RV Power Cord Adapter Plug - 50 Amp Female to 15 Amp Male - Round, part # A10-1550DAVP. You will not have enough power draw to run everything in your 5th wheel, but it should be enough to power your slides and possibly some lights, while you are recharging your battery.
